3. Benefits and challenges posed by 5G technology today

Benefits of 5G technology: 5G technology has revolutionized the communications industry by offering a number of significant benefits. One of the highlights is connection speed, which is up to 100 times faster than 4G technology. This allows for faster and smoother data transfer, resulting in a significant improvement in user experience. Besides, low latency is another key benefit, which means that Response times are almost instantaneous, which is ideal for applications that require quick interaction in real time, such as autonomous vehicles or telemedicine.

Challenges of 5G technology: Despite all its advantages, the implementation of 5G technology is not without challenges. One of the most important challenges is the required infrastructure to support the deployment of the 5G network. Since 5G technology uses higher frequencies and millimeter waves that have a more limited range, a higher density of antennas and base stations is required to ensure adequate coverage. Another challenge is safety, since the greater number of connected devices increases the risk of cyberattacks and vulnerabilities on the network.

6. Impact of 5G technology on industry and the global economy

Benefits of 5G technology in the industry and global economy

5G technology has begun to revolutionize the way industries operate and the economy is boosted globally. The high speed and low latency offered by this fifth generation network allows for greater efficiency in production processes, which translates into a reduction in costs and product development times. Furthermore, the ability to connect a greater number of devices simultaneously and without interruptions enables the creation of new, highly innovative solutions and services.

This technological advancement has a significant impact on key sectors such as transportation, healthcare, agriculture and manufacturing. For example, in the field of transportation, the deployment of 5G will allow greater interconnection of vehicles and the implementation of safer and more efficient autonomous driving systems. In the health sector, the adoption of this technology will facilitate telemedicine and the implementation of connected medical devices, improving the quality of care and allowing faster access to specialized services. In agriculture, 5G connectivity will enable the use of sensors and drones to monitor and optimize crop irrigation and fertilization, thus increasing productivity and reducing environmental impact.
